Arboles and Pagosa Springs are places in Colorado.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
Pagosa Springs has the higher population (1,718 vs 396 in Arboles). Arboles has the higher median household income ($42,500 vs $36,712 in Pagosa Springs). Pagosa Springs has the higher median home value ($353,800 vs $282,500 in Arboles).
Population, income & housing
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 396 | 1,718 |
| Median age | 52.9 yrs | 34.5 yrs |
| Median household income | $42,500 | $36,712 |
| Median home value | $282,500 | $353,800 |
| Median gross rent | — | $1,068 |
| Housing units | 239 | 1,005 |
| Homeownership rate | 86.3% | 47.6%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 16.6% | 23.3% |
| Unemployment rate | 4.1% | 4.2% |
Trends (ACS 5-year, 2019–2023)
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 326 → 396 (+21.5%) | 2,057 → 1,718 (-16.5%) |
| Median household income | $40,938 → $42,500 (+3.8%) | $25,375 → $36,712 (+44.7%) |
| Median home value | $201,300 → $282,500 (+40.3%) | $227,500 → $353,800 (+55.5%) |
| Median gross rent | $693 → $1,125 (+62.3%) | $766 → $1,068 (+39.4%) |

Age & race/ethnicity
Age distribution (share)
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| Under 5 | 0.0% | 6.1% |
| 5 to 17 | 9.8% | 19.3% |
| 18 to 24 | 5.1% | 10.8% |
| 25 to 34 | 2.8% | 15.0% |
| 35 to 44 | 0.0% | 11.4% |
| 45 to 54 | 38.9% | 7.0% |
| 55 to 64 | 15.7% | 13.2% |
| 65 to 74 | 11.4% | 10.3% |
| 75 and over | 16.4% | 6.8% |
Race & ethnicity (share)
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| White (non-Hispanic) | 41.2% | 43.7% |
| Black or African American | 0.0% | 0.1% |
| American Indian & Alaska Native | 3.5% | 0.8% |
| Asian | 0.0% | 0.6% |
| Native Hawaiian & Pacific Islander | 0.0% | 2.3% |
| Some other race | 2.3% | 0.2% |
| Two or more races | 2.3% | 5.1% |
| Hispanic or Latino | 50.8% | 47.2% |
Educational attainment (age 25+)
Share of adults 25+
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| No high school diploma | 37.4% | 8.4% |
| High school graduate | 10.4% | 37.2% |
| Some college or associate's | 35.6% | 31.1% |
| Bachelor's degree | 10.4% | 14.1% |
| Graduate or professional degree | 6.2% | 9.2% |
Commute to work
How workers get to work (share)
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| Drove alone | 73.6% | 55.7% |
| Carpooled | 5.5% | 26.7% |
| Public transit | 0.0% | 2.7% |
| Walked | 0.0% | 5.8% |
| Bicycle | 0.0% | 0.8% |
| Worked from home | 20.9% | 8.3% |
| Other means | 0.0% | 0.0% |
Housing
Units in structure (share)
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| 1-unit, detached | 70.7% | 59.3% |
| 1-unit, attached | 0.0% | 8.2% |
| 2 to 4 units | 0.0% | 9.6% |
| 5 to 19 units | 1.7% | 9.1% |
| 20 or more units | 0.0% | 1.3% |
| Mobile home & other | 27.6% | 12.6% |
Poverty & households
| Arboles | Pagosa Springs | |
|---|---|---|
| Poverty rate | 12.9% | 23.0% |
| Average household size | 2.48 | 2.36 |
| Mean commute (minutes) | 20 | 16 |
| Median year structure built | 1992 | 1979 |
